- 摘要:
-
文章选取13宗大中型水库,根据2021年水生态监测和调查成果,并结合历史情况,分析水库水质和营养状态,并进行蓝藻水华风险评估。结果显示,汛期6宗水库水质优于或达到Ⅱ类,非汛期7宗水库水质优于或达到Ⅱ类。2021年7宗水库的营养状态为中营养,6宗水库营养状态为轻度富营养。2021年藻类总丰度超过水华发生限值(1×107 ind/L)的水库有6宗。2010—2021年,发生过蓝藻水华的水库有9宗,尚未发生过蓝藻水华的水库有4宗。综合分析,2宗水库藻类水华发生风险等级为低,2宗水库水华发生风险等级为中,9宗水库藻类水华发生风险等级为高。
- Abstract:
-
In this paper, 13 large and medium-sized reservoirs were selected to analyze the water quality and nutritional status of the reservoirs according to the results of water ecological monitoring and investigation in 2021, combined with the historical situation, and the risk assessment of cyanobacteria bloom was carried out. The results show that the water quality of 6 reservoirs in flood season is better than or up to Class II, and that of 7 reservoirs in non-flood season is better than or up to Class II. In 2021, the nutritive status of 7 reservoirs was medium nutrition, and the nutritive status of 6 reservoirs was mild eutrophic. In 2021, there were 6 reservoirs with total algae abundance exceeding the limit of bloom occurrence (1×107 ind/L). From 2010 to 2021, there were 9 reservoirs with cyanobacteria blooms and 4 reservoirs with no cyanobacteria blooms. Comprehensive analysis showed that the risk level of algal blooms in 2 reservoirs is low, the risk level of algal blooms in 2 reservoirs is medium, and the risk level of algal blooms in 9 reservoirs is high.
